During a Senate Finance Committee hearing on June 25, 2025, Treasury Secretary Scott Bessent confirmed a confrontation with FHFA Director Bill Pulte from last year, clarifying he said he would 'kick his ass' rather than punch him. Bessent characterized the dispute as a 'locker room' fight and said he had a good exchange with Pulte recently. Pulte was recently named acting director of national intelligence, replacing Tulsi Gabbard.
